2000 BMW Z3 vs. 2000 Chevrolet Camaro

To start off, both 2000 BMW Z3 and 2000 Chevrolet Camaro were released in the same year (2000).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 3,390 cc (6 cylinders), 2000 Chevrolet Camaro is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2000 BMW Z3 (228 HP @ 5900 RPM) has 70 more horse power than 2000 Chevrolet Camaro. (158 HP @ 4600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2000 BMW Z3 should accelerate faster than 2000 Chevrolet Camaro.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2000 Chevrolet Camaro weights approximately 13 kg more than 2000 BMW Z3.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2000 BMW Z3 (301 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 30 more torque (in Nm) than 2000 Chevrolet Camaro. (271 Nm @ 3600 RPM). This means 2000 BMW Z3 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2000 Chevrolet Camaro. 2000 BMW Z3 has automatic transmission and 2000 Chevrolet Camaro has manual transmission. 2000 Chevrolet Camaro will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2000 BMW Z3 will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

2000 BMW Z3 2000 Chevrolet Camaro
Make BMW Chevrolet
Model Z3 Camaro
Year Released 2000 2000
Body Type Convertible Coupe
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2996 cc 3390 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Horse Power 228 HP 158 HP
Engine RPM 5900 RPM 4600 RPM
Torque 301 Nm 271 Nm
Torque RPM 3500 RPM 3600 RPM
Engine Bore Size 84 mm 92 mm
Engine Stroke Size 89.6 mm 84 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Automatic Manual
Number of Seats 2 seats 4 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 1400 kg 1413 kg
Vehicle Length 4060 mm 4910 mm
Vehicle Width 1750 mm 1890 mm
Vehicle Height 1300 mm 1310 mm
Wheelbase Size 2450 mm 2450 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 51 L 68 L
